Job description

This position will provide engineering designs and recommendations for assigned processes and new technologies to develop the most cost effective solutions for manufacturing.

Job Duties
  • Prepare, review, approve and distribute the instructions for the production of intermediates or APIs, according to written procedures.
  • Produce APIs and intermediates according to preapproved instructions;
  • Review all production batch records and ensure that these are completed and signed.
  • Report and evaluate all production deviations and ensure that all critical deviations are investigated (with the conclusions recorded).
  • Ensure that production facilities are clean and disinfected;
  • Ensure that all necessary calibrations are performed (with records kept)
  • Maintain the premises and equipment (with records kept).
  • Ensure that validation protocols and reports are reviewed and approved;
  • Evaluate proposed changes in product, process or equipment.
  • Responsible for ensuring that new and modified facilities and equipment are qualified.
  • Review and analyze manufacturing needs, formulate solutions and implement changes to optimize manufacturing processes.
  • Manage assigned projects in order to complete each project on time, under budget and within the design parameters.
  • Provide training for API processes.
  • Other duties as assigned.
Education, Experience & Competencies
  • BS in Chemical Engineering.
  • 5 years experience with FDA/GMP. Experience with DEA guidelines and regulations a plus.
  • Ability to present ideas effectively to all levels of management.
